Pinching in electron-hole liquid of germanium

Description

The phenomenon of negative differential resistance in an electron-hole-drop (EHD) system in germanium, when the drops occupy a considerable part of a sample and when conductivity at a constant current through EHD is possible, was discovered and investigated. Negative resistance is observed in fields of 1 Vxcm-1 and is accompanied by current oscillations in the sample. It is shown that this phenomenon may be attributed to the pinching in the electron-hole liquid
